多くの人が持っている必要がありますが、記録の知識を習得していない会議の前に、CSSを読んでスクラッチ。
CSS Definitive Guideの4 ...
、
ディスプレイプロパティは、最も一般的なブロック要素内のブロック、インライン要素に加えて、いくつかの特性があります
表示リストアイテム: 内部リストアイテムインラインボックス複数のカセット、および表示タイプをブロックするには、このタイプの外部の表示素子。
表示-外: これらのキーワードは、外部ディスプレイ型の要素を指定し、実際には、フローレイアウトにおけるその役割です。
ディスプレイ内部: ような table
と ruby
、このレイアウトモデルは、子供たちと後ろの要素が複数の役割を有することができ、複雑な内部構造を有しています。このクラスのキーワードは、これらの「内部」表示タイプを定義するために使用される、とだけこれらの特定のレイアウトモデルに理にかなっています。
ディスプレイボックス: これらの値は、表示セル要素を生成するかどうかを定義します。
レガシー・ディスプレイ: のためのCSS2 display
単一のキーワードを使用してプロパティの構文、同じレイアウトパターンとブロックレベル段インライン変異体は、別個の鍵を必要とします
II。
添加の前に、リンクのラベルで導入された外部スタイルシートの導入は、また@import文で外部スタイルを読み込むことができます。
例えば:@import URL(xxx.css)すべて。
URL(xxx.css)画面@import。
URL(xxx.css)投影@import、印刷;
メディア、メディア記述子は、URLに提供するものを紹介
@importのstyle要素内のコマンドが、他のCSSルールの前に許可されていない、それは動作しません。
そして、外部スタイルシートで使用することができます!
当社は、リンクタグは、コンテンツの残りの部分は、それは、これらのプロパティ値と理解することは比較的容易であることを知っています。
relが関係は、スタイルシート、ここで指定されている、と呼ばれ、「関係」、(関係)です。
typeプロパティの値は、常にテキスト/ cssのではありません。
HREF、その値は、絶対アドレスまたは相対アドレスであることができるスタイルシートのURLです。
私は以前に気づいていない次の二つの属性:メディアとタイトルを
メディア:それは、1つ以上のマルチメディア記述(メディア記述子)の値、およびメディア機能の指定されたタイプを有しています。カンマで区切られたメディア記述子の複数。
例えば:<リンクのrel = "スタイルシート" タイプ= "テキスト/ cssの" のhref = "style.cssに" メディア= "画面で、投影">
スタイルシート(代替スタイルシート)の候補には、ユーザー自身の選択は、文書が候補スタイルシートをレンダリングするために使用された場合にのみ、もあります
これは、などのFirefox、として、候補スタイルをサポートするブラウザが必要です
構造ルール:ルールは、2つの基本的な部分から構成さ:セレクタと宣言ブロック